As a young man at gunshows I used to get the Green boxes of 44 cheap. Not sure of era , but still have one partial box -Ill check Of course I went and shot them , along with a passel of now collectable ammo. They were a novelty , being black powder and having a delayed hangfire of about 3 seconds. Taught me a lesson , and to this day I wait about 10 seconds before opening the action on a dud
